Roles

  • Independent Consultant Dermatologist based in Berkshire, providing private medical and surgical dermatology through Reading Dermatology (Dr Pratsou Dermatology Ltd) located at Spire Dunedin Hospital.
  • Consultant Dermatologist at Spire Dunedin Hospital, Reading, offering specialist clinics for acne, mole checks, paediatric dermatology and skin cancer diagnosis and treatment.
  • Founder and Medical Director of Reading Dermatology / Dr Pratsou Dermatology Ltd, a consultant-led dermatology practice delivering evidence-based, personalised care for adults and children.
  • Regular provider of educational sessions and ‘top tips’ dermatology update courses for GPs, including guidance on when to refer and how to recognise benign versus malignant skin lesions.

Qualifications

  • MBChB, University of Sheffield (2005).
  • Specialist dermatology training completed in the West Midlands, including a dedicated three-month post in paediatric dermatology at Birmingham Children’s Hospital.
  • Previously completed core medical training in Nottingham while obtaining Membership of the Royal College of Physicians.
  • Consultant Dermatologist and British Skin Foundation spokesperson.
